Ronald N. Tutor, Chairman and CEO of Tutor Perini Corporation, just announced that his civil and building construction company was retained as contractor for the Hudson Yards development in Midtown Manhattan. The Hudson Yards development, a 26-acre mixed-use space, will encompass residences, office space and a retail center. Restaurants, bars, cafes, a hotel and a school make the development a unique and diverse project. Construction will begin mid-year.
